Objectives
At the end of the learning session you will be able to:
- Terminate an employment contract at any moment of the employment relationship in compliance with Luxembourg law
- Prevent abusive dismissal and its consequences for your organisation
- Act upon resignation from an employee
- Terminate with mutual consent
Content
The session will cover the following content:
- Dismissal of the employee:
- During the trial period
- Preliminary meeting
- Dismissal with notice period
- Dismissal with immediate effect for serious grounds
- Protections against dismissal
- Collective dismissals:
- Step plan
- Negotiation of a social plan
- Conciliation procedure
- Abusive dismissal:
- Definition
- Time limits for action
- Damages / compensation
- Reinstatement of the employee
- Settlement
- Resignation by the employee:
- Resignation with notice period
- Resignation with immediate effect for serious grounds
- Action by the employer
- Termination upon mutual consent:
- Usual terms and conditions of termination agreements
- Challenging the agreement
